Bug Description

Similar to bug 1168513, write_galera_info does not test the values $con->{status}->{wsrep_local_state_uuid}->{Value} and $con->{status}->{wsrep_last_committed}->{Value} before using them, resulting in the perl error:
Use of uninitialized value in concatenation (.) or string at /data/bin/xb-2.1-lp1190335/innobackupex line 1543.
Which leaves the xtrabackup binary running but terminates innobackupex.

I know, it is a silly bug, you should only use --galera-info against a real PXC server but I stumbled into it when testing something else.
